PETROLEUM CLUB OF ANCHORAGE INC, founded in 1958, is a community nonprofit that reported $1.8M in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ue grew 18% year-over-year, indicating healthy expansion. Expenses of $1.7M left a modest 8% surplus.

Mission

TO AID THE ASSOCIATION AND FELLOWSHIP OF MEN AND WOMEN CONNECTED WITH THE PETROLEUM INDUSTRY.
